Output 7893dffa83ac9c633ab2c573b9dc49dd952d108f61ed54e26705caeb2b6f6d97:2

value
1640300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c916550a5819df4c1a2be41efe03a64bf2f1964d OP_EQUALVERIFY OP_CHECKSIG
address
1KLFaE5yADpmbbSBKYTeQCWHZki1TXPYFH
transaction
7893dffa83ac9c633ab2c573b9dc49dd952d108f61ed54e26705caeb2b6f6d97
spent
true